Memorial
The on First Street in , is a commemoration of the creation of the Concatenated Order of Hoo-Hoo. The Hoo-Hoo is a fraternal society of lumbermen that was founded in Gurdon in 1892. is situated 3,800 feet southwest of Rose Hedge Cemetery.
